Serving 612 students in grades Prekindergarten-6, Prairie Crossing Elementary School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Colorado for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 51% (which is higher than the Colorado state average of 33%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 61% (which is higher than the Colorado state average of 45%).
The student-teacher ratio of 17:1 is higher than the Colorado state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ment is 29%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Colorado state average of 51% (majority Hispanic).

School Overview

Prairie Crossing Elementary School's student population of 612 students has declined by 9% over five school years.
The teacher population of 36 teachers has declined by 12% over five school years.
